The image depicts a street scene in Kandahar, Afghanistan, likely during late afternoon or early evening. In the immediate foreground on the right, a mobile vendor cart covered with a red and white patterned cloth displays a large mound of sunflower seeds. A white plastic bag and a metal scoop hang from its side. Partially visible blue wheels support the cart. Further left, a second mobile vendor cart, equipped with a red canopy, holds a substantial pile of shredded orange material, possibly carrots or a related food item. A man with a dark beard, wearing a dark shalwar kameez and waistcoat, is seated on this cart, facing right. To the left of this cart, the rear of a silver sedan is visible, and a person in a white burqa walks away from the camera. In the mid-ground and background on the right, a row of interconnected vendor kiosks with red tops and white bases lines the street. One kiosk has text in Dari or Pashto and the English word "Time" displayed on its red awning, below which "جوس سالم اسپشل جوس" (Juice, Healthy, Special Juice) is written. An electrical pole with multiple gray utility boxes attached stands near these kiosks. The road surface is asphalt. In the distant background on the left, a light-colored, dusty hill or dune is visible against a pale sky.
